Cheddar Bay Biscuit Bread Recipe


  • Author: Hugo
  • Total Time: 45-50 minutes
  • Yield: 1 loaf (about 8 slices) 1x

Description

Cheddar Bay Biscuit Bread is a savory, cheesy bread inspired by the famous Cheddar Bay Biscuits. This quick and easy bread combines shredded cheddar cheese, a buttery garlic topping, and a tender crumb, perfect for serving alongside soups, salads, or as a flavorful snack.


Ingredients

Scale

Bread Ingredients

  • 1 3/4 cups all-purpose flour
  • 1 tablespoon white granulated sugar
  • 1 tablespoon baking powder
  • 1/2 teaspoon table salt or sea salt
  • 2 1/2 cups shredded cheddar cheese (freshly shredded preferred)
  • 1 egg
  • 1 cup milk (whole or 2%)
  • 4 tablespoons butter, melted

Topping Ingredients

  • 1 teaspoon garlic powder
  • 1 teaspoon onion powder
  • 1 teaspoon parsley flakes
  • 4 tablespoons butter, melted

Instructions

  1. Prepare the dry mix: Whisk together the all-purpose flour, white sugar, baking powder, and salt in a large mixing bowl to evenly distribute all dry ingredients.
  2. Add cheese and wet ingredients: Stir in the shredded cheddar cheese, then add the egg, milk, and melted butter to the dry mixture. Mix until just combined, being careful not to overmix.
  3. Prepare baking pan: Spray or grease a 9 x 5-inch bread pan thoroughly to prevent sticking.
  4. Bake the bread: Spread the batter evenly into the prepared bread pan. Bake in a preheated oven at 350°F (175°C) for 35 to 40 minutes, or until the center is cooked through and the top is golden brown.
  5. Make the topping: While the bread is baking, combine garlic powder, onion powder, parsley flakes, and melted butter in a small microwave-safe bowl. Heat in the microwave until the butter is fully melted, then mix well.
  6. Apply topping and cool: Immediately after removing the bread from the oven, pour the melted butter topping evenly over the hot bread. Let the bread cool in the pan for about 10 minutes before removing to a wire rack or serving.

Notes

  • Use freshly shredded cheddar cheese for the best texture and flavor; pre-shredded cheese may contain anti-caking agents.
  • Make sure not to overmix the batter to keep the bread tender.
  • If you prefer, whole milk will give a richer flavor, but 2% milk works well for a lighter option.
  • Keep the bread warm by covering loosely with foil after adding the topping if serving later.
  • The topping butter mixture can be adjusted for more or less garlic and herbs according to preference.
